Fruit Heights is a small city in central Davis County. This city shares a border with Kaysville to the north and west, Farmington to the west and south, and the Wasatch Mountains to the east. Present-day Fruit Heights was settled by Mormon pioneer families in 1850, three years after settlers arrived in nearby Kaysville. The settlement sprang up around a Pony Express and stagecoach trail called Mountain Road. The community was referred to as "Old Mountain Road" until 1939, when the town was officially incorporated and adopted the name Fruit Heights. At that time, 100 residents lived in the town.
